'Return to Sleepy Hollow' at Disney's Fort Wilderness Resort & Campground Begins September 28. The galloping ghosts and Headless Horseman would put you right in the midst of the Halloween fun. Shows are at 8:00 p.m. and 10:00 p.m.
Halloween at Disney Springs might also be a possibility depending on the time of your arrival. Check out the DJ Dance Party and Face Painting by Enjoy Your Face. While at Disney Springs, I would also suggest stopping by the
PhotoPass Service Studio to take a few pictures, especially if you are dressed in your costumed best! Just remember that activities are subject to change so check activity schedules when you arrive!
